2 NBFCs derecognised

Our Bureau

HYDERABAD: RBI has cancelled the certificates of registration granted to two Hyderabad-based NBFCs, Dalia Securities Ltd and Chillakuru Investments Pvt Ltd.

While the registered office of Dalia Securities is located in Esamia Bazar, the office of Chillakuru Investments is situated in Dwarakapuri Colony here.

In two separate announcements, RBI said that following the cancellation of registrations, these entities should not transact the business of NBFCs.
